Dixon has cultivated an independent solo discography of deep contemporary R&B that includes the full-lengths Higher Ground (2015), Expectations (2021), and The R&B You Love (2023), among numerous EPs and singles.
Born and raised in South Central Los Angeles, specifically the neighborhood of Watts, Dixon grew up in a devoutly religious household that forbade secular music, though his parents were involved in the church as musicians. Deeply involved as a youngster in dance and musical theater, Dixon eventually got into singing, writing, and producing R&B.
He established himself during the first half of the 2010s by writing material for Tyrese and that singer’s TGT project with Ginuwine and Tank, such as the single “Sex Never Felt Better.”
